The records of the Passport Division of the Department
of State reflect that EDWARD PAUL ABBEY was issued passport number
499010 on Avugust 22, 1951, for a proposed ten month travel to
England, Scotland, France and Germany to attend the University of
Edinburgh on a Fulbright Scholarship. He stated in his passport
: . ‘ application dated August 8, 1951, at Albuquerque, New Mexico, that —
= /. he intended to depart from the port of New York by ship about
ef December 15, 1951. This passport was not valid for travel to
Japan, Okinawa, Czechoslovakia or Bulgaria.
On his passport application the appointee listed his
permanent resid as Home, Pennsylvania, amd gave his mailing
address as in Of PAUL Ro YABBEY of Home, Pennsylvania,
